Two Users--One Calibre Library?
Pardon this first newbie question--I did do some searching for an answer to what must be a pretty basic question.
I have a lot of non-DRM books in my library (public domain) and want to buy a second Kindle for my son and load a SELECTION of these books onto his Kindle via Calibre. I use Calibre on my own Kindle. I haven't bought the 2nd Kindle yet, but when I do--what will be the process to follow to not mess up the "sharing" process? Thanks in advance! |

AFAIK calibre doesn't care which kindle you have plugged in. Should be no problem at all as long as you only plug in one at a time.
I have used my calibre library with 4 different devices, SOny, kindle, Galaxy Tab and Ipad. Nothing bad happened |

You might want to look at the Reading List plugin. That makes it easy to queue books up for specific devices and then sync them the next time that particular device is plugged in. Unlike most of Calibre that particular plugin can even distinguish between different devices of the same type so that you can queue the books for each user separately.
